>> > actually, i found very good thing,
>> > once i get connection from home to office , i can easily connect
>> > back to home without knowing my home IP.
>> >
>> >
>> > 1)create a tunnel to connect to server abc using SSH from user foo
>> >
>> > #ssh -R 988:localhost:22 [email protected]   (from home)
>> >
>> > once u got connection, dnt restart ur home pc
>>
>> You will have to tell that to MTNL. They love to drop your connection
>> (which ever so often wont be reestablished without a modem reboot).
>> Bingo you have a brand new ip and have to run back home from office to
>> do 1.
